Пакетные файлы: особенности, структура и требования
Опубликованно 15.12.2018 00:38
Вероятно все пользователи Windows, которые очень часто к средствам командной строки или консоли PowerShell, почти полная аналогия со старыми DOS-систем, обращали внимание на то, что в самой операционной системе, несмотря на приоритетность доступа к определенным функциям или инструментам Windows, иногда требует так называемый Batch-файлы, причем именно установить в консольном режиме. Какие они? Обычные пользователи не знают об этом почти ничего. Но продвинутые пользователи и программисты используют возможности таких апплетов достаточно часто. Как это все работает и что нужно, читайте дальше. Что пакетные файлы?
Вообще, файлы этого типа относятся к исполняемой среде операционной системы апплеты применяется и содержат команды, которые через последовательный переход для выполнения одной или нескольких операций. Как правило, они с расширением CMD или BAT (реже - PS1). Поскольку содержание таких объектов практически одинаков, мы рассмотрим именно пакетный объекты из английские имена и их сокращение, возникла для объяснения расширения, предопределяющего тип файла.
Если вы посмотрите внимательно и на растяжках, и на значки, и на свойства Windows-Batch-файлы в том же «проводнике», несложно предположить, что такие программки будут либо в командной строке или PowerShell в консоли. Эта консоль является аналогом первого инструмента, но с более широкими возможностями. Хотя пакетные командные файлы программ, которые по своей структуре они ничем не отличаются от обычных текстовых объектов точно. Только она содержит определенный набор команд. Также очень часто и в любое текстовое поле (например, «Нажмите любую клавишу для продолжения»), которые появляются на экране, когда команда, после их подтверждения или выбора настраиваемого действия. Основная Цель
Что же касается использования пакетных файлов, считается, что они чаще всего применяются для выполнения цепочки последовательных процессов с целью автоматизации, так сказать, рутинных действий. Но мало кто знает, что иногда они могут использоваться и для запуска других программ в среде операционных систем Windows, при запуске с обычными средствами это невозможно (например, из-за существующих ограничений на уровне самой системы, как в Windows RT, или в отношении права для конкретного пользователя).
Самый простой пример стандартного апплета этого типа можно назвать, обязательно присутствуют в более ранних версиях Windows файл Autoexec.bat, который отвечает за настройки старта системы. Пожалуйста, обратите внимание, что настройки появились через команду msconfig, по сегодняшним меркам относительно Нова, и все бразды правления были настройки параметров старта операционной системы. Команд в пакетных файлах
Что касается основных команд, чтобы с ними не много хлопот даже самому неискушенному пользователю. Если вы принадлежите к тому поколению, которое еще в школе на уроках естественнонаучного имеет примитивный язык программирования Basic, а затем, возможно, и Паскаль, сходство используемых команд очевидна. Тот факт, что параметры пакетный файл таким образом, что они подразумевают использование команды операторов, которые были представлены ранее, а именно на этих языках (if, goto, петли и т. д.). Как правило, для вывода выполнение команд на экран и просмотр SMS-сообщений, используйте команду echo, параметр on или off, соответствующий включить или отключить. Часто эта команда используется и для ввода определенных переменных или так называемых подстановочных значений (для этого дополнительных символов).
Чтобы не заниматься вовсе, чтобы лишняя описание всех команд, пользователь может получить всю необходимую информацию и самостоятельно, воспользовавшись вызов справки в командной строке с помощью команды help. Если вам нужна информация о какой-либо команде, либо совмещение с помощником (например, echo help) или сочетание help /команде? (Например, help /AT?). Таким образом, не трудно догадаться, что каждая из команд, в командной строке могут быть включены в список выполняемых операций в пакетных файлах. Как создать исполняемый файл?
Создать теперь давайте попробуем самое простое сам файл. Для этого подойдет любой текстовый редактор, включая обычный «блокнот», встроенного во все версии Windows. Вы можете также файл-и FAR-Manager, который работает аналогично Norton Commander. Но для удобства мы будем на «блокнот». Например, откройте через BAT-файл, это текстовый объект с именем Commands на диске D.
Введите команду start D:Commands.txt а затем сохранить в поле тип файла выберите «Все файлы» и переименуйте расширение BAT сам.
После этого запустите его двойным кликом или через меню ПКМ и посмотрите на результат. Если такого файла нет в указанной локации существует, эта команда может использоваться, чтобы создать его. Только это будет выглядеть так: start file>D:Commands.txt. Функции запуска и выполнения
Но это был самый простой пример. Как правило, для выполнения компиляции команды в пакетный файл использовать, лучше всего использовать стартовый файл с правами администратора, что сравнимо с командной строки запустить именно с такими правами. В большинстве случаев необходимо при проведении настройки системы, обойти всевозможные блокировки и т. д. Это может быть как основное требование, хотя для многих необходимость такого запуска апплетов не хватает. Пример запуска исполняемого файла
Теперь рассмотрим некоторые примеры. Предположим, мы имеем уже готовый сценарий в виде BAT-файла, так что вы можете перезагрузить операционную систему в тестере режим. Запустите нужный апплет, нажмите любую клавишу для продолжения, и тогда мы попадаем в меню действия выбрать.
Как видно из приведенного примера, с помощью такого файла можно удалить системные обновления, скачать ее в тесте или в обычном режиме или для получения дополнительной информации. Ввод отдельных цифр и обеспечивает выполнение последовательности команд, которой она назначена. Более Сложные Конфигурации
Если вы на более сложные примеры мы предлагаем посмотреть на уникальный сценарий изменения цифровой подписи исполняемых файлов и связанных с ним динамических библиотек на «Microsoft», которые особенно часто нужны для установки приложений в Windows RT версии, которые в штатном режиме, кроме «магазина», вы не сможете произвести установку.
Только в этом случае вы должны сначала запустить систему в тестовом режиме, а затем запустить нужный сценарий. Вопросы пакетная обработка информации
Что же касается пакетной обработки файлов, касающихся исполняемых. BAT-скрипты эти процессы могут точно последовательным действовать на основе содержащихся в апплете команды. Однако часто под пакетную обработку, чтобы понять и еще такой же трансформации или проведение тех или иных операций не по отношению к одному и к группе файлов. Чтобы было понятнее, это часто можно увидеть при конвертировании аудио и видео форматы, если вы несколько исходных объектов для преобразования в другой формат после конвертации. Пакетные команды не могут быть использованы здесь, но все равно что-то аналогия с процессами попросили, через активировал Пуск-программки. Автор: Панькова Оксана Владимировна 28. Сентябрь 2018
Категория: обо всём